Winter Photography Festival Coming to Yellowstone National Park ... In West Yellowstone
The Yellowstone Winter Photo Festival is right around the corner. Kurt Repanshek photo.
Think you've got a great winter shot of Yellowstone National Park? Then plan on heading to West Yellowstone on March 11 for the park's Winter Photo Festival.
The festival is sponsored by the National Park Service and the Grizzly and Wolf Discovery Center in West Yellowstone. It will be held at the West Yellowstone Visitor Information Center on Wednesday, March 11 at 7:00 PM.
Photographers are asked to bring digital photos on a thumb drive or photo CD so they can display and narrate their photos. Interested photographers should contact Rich Jelhe at 307-344-2840 for more information. Participants must register by Friday, March 6.
This free program is the third in this year’s winter speaker series. The West Yellowstone Visitor Information Center is located at the corner of Canyon and Yellowstone in West Yellowstone, Montana.
